Problem
Existing construction toy sets lack flexibility and variety in interconnection options, limiting user creativity and assembly possibilities, particularly in terms of position and rotation of components.
Innovation Solution
The introduction of wafer-shaped construction elements with receiver passages and protruding keys that allow for slidable mating and rotation, enabling multiple interconnection configurations through uniform dimensioning and shaping, along with the inclusion of slidable elements and accessory components for enhanced compatibility and complexity.

A construction toy set with multiple construction elements, the construction elements having a generally wafer shaped element body with one or more internal receiver passages extending through the element body, the receiver passages having one or more receiver tracks extending laterally across the receiver passage, the element body having one or more element keys protruding laterally from the element body, element key dimensioning providing for insertion of an element key of a first construction element in a receiver track of a second construction element and for slidable mating of the element key of the first construction element with the receiver track of the second construction element.
